It’s Our 20th Anniversary! In 1999, the Fremont Family Resource Center (FRC) opened its doors to help improve the quality of life for local residents. For the past 20 years, the FRC’s 24 partner agencies have offered a variety of services to Tri-City families including counseling, employment services, public benefits, housing support, health insurance enrollment, drop-in childcare and financial services to name a few. The Fremont FRC is unique in many ways and here are five key things to know about us: 1. The FRC is a one-stop shop where Tri-City residents can get their needs met without traveling all over Alameda County. (See agency list on pages 6-7.)

2. We’re one of the largest FRCs in the country! 3. Our Welcome Center has a team of bilingual Resource Specialists speaking nine different languages to help visitors. 4. Discovery Cove Childcare Center provides free drop-in childcare for FRC customers attending appointments and low-cost drop-in care for the community. 5. The FRC hosts special events such as voter education, citizenship and cultural events, onsite job recruiting, insurance enrollment, car seat inspections plus a host of workshops.
